NH_3/CO_2制冷系统的研究 被引量:14

Research on NH_3/CO_2 Refrigeration System
下载PDF
导出
摘要 介绍了CO_2作为冷媒的主要特点及其制冷系统形式,论述了NH_3/CO_2制冷技术的研究内容和试验结论,提出了NH_3/CO_2制冷系统的最佳适用范围。通过大量的系统试验数据和分析表明,NH_3/CO_2制冷系统有着极高的运行效率和安全、环保效应。CO_2因其环保和节能的特点在不久的将来将成为最有前景的制冷剂之一。 In this paper, the main character of CO2 being a cooling medium and its refrigeration system were introduced, the NH3/CO2 refrigeration technology and experimental results were then discussed, and the suitable temperature range for using the NH3/CO2 refrigeration technology was also presented. Through many data results and analysis, it showed that NH3/CO2 refrigeration system has a very high running efficiency, and safety and environment effects. CO2 will be one of the most promising refrigerants in the near future because of its environment and energy saving effect.
